1-Bromoheneicosane

Identification

AtomsBr: 1, C: 21, H: 43
CAS4276-50-0
FormulaC21H43Br
ID1-Bromoheneicosane
InChIC21H43Br/c1-2-3-4-5-6-7-8-9-10-11-12-13-14-15-16-17-18-19-20-21-22/h2-21H2,1H3
InChI KeyABHHLNIVRZCBKH-UHFFFAOYSA-N
IUPAC Name1-bromohenicosane
Molecular Weight (kg/kmol)375.47

Physical Properties

Acentric factor0.831
Critical pressure (bar)9.98
Critical temperature (°C)553.32
Critical volume (m³/kmol)1.2735
Dipole moment
Melting temperature (°C)113.08
Normal boiling temperature (°C)397
